Use interfaces appropriate to the installed version
The project should begin with the vendor's API documentation for the installed SOLIDWORKS version. Identify supported interfaces for the required task rather than relying on undocumented behaviour or an example written for a different release. The linked guide is a reference point, not proof that a given operation is available in your configuration.
Distinguish SOLIDWORKS Design, additional modules and any PDM environment. Confirm licences, permissions, dependencies and execution requirements before advertising compatibility to users. The MCP connector exposes selected operations to the assistant; it does not imply unlimited access to all components or authorise every action supported by the underlying API.

Choose a document or design scope
Reading document properties, preparing an assembly summary or performing a controlled export are possible scenarios to qualify. They are not asserted as features of the customer implementation cited above. For each, check that the available interface supplies the required information and that the output can be compared with an engineering-approved reference.
Avoid combining too many transformations in the first task. Describe the input document, expected fields, exclusions and output format. If a request has an ambiguous name or lacks a revision, ask for clarification. Silently choosing a file whose validity is unknown creates a design risk even when the operation itself executes successfully.
04
Keep control of references, units and revisions
Acceptance tests must cover document context, not just the presence of an assistant response. Define file-selection rules, how properties are read and how units are displayed. Check how missing references, alternative configurations and unexpected revisions are reported. Adapt these checks to the actual operations in the agreed scope.
For a modification or export, identify the targets and destination before execution. Approval for one document state must not silently cover another. A competent reviewer examines the result after the action. MCP integration does not replace a design review, demonstrate conformity with an engineering standard or authorise a part to enter manufacture.

Measure a benefit useful to the engineering office
Compare representative tasks with and without the assistant workflow. Count preparation, search, inspection and correction time until the result is accepted. A quickly executed command followed by a lengthy verification may not improve the overall job. Track wrong-file or wrong-reference errors separately from wording problems.
Hunter BI's qualitative report is not an independent measurement. Agree a sample and acceptance criteria before the pilot. Released time may help the team handle work, but it does not automatically demonstrate a financial saving or improved mechanical quality. Keep conclusions limited to the tasks, documents and configurations actually evaluated, including the cases that failed.

Organise access and continuity of work
The assistant needs an explicit access perimeter: authorised documents, available commands and actions requiring a human decision. Information sent to the model can be sensitive even when it consists only of names, properties or references. Project owners should know those flows and the traces retained by each service.
The operating package should record tested versions, dependencies, incident ownership and how to suspend the connector. Define a procedure for returning to an approved working state after an incident. Updates to SOLIDWORKS, an additional module or the assistant should trigger checks on affected operations before their continued availability is confirmed. Agree handover and maintenance responsibilities rather than presuming ongoing support.
Frequently asked questions
Can the assistant approve a part for manufacture?
This page does not claim that capability. A connector provides access to defined operations; it is not mechanical validation, standards certification or manufacturing approval. The engineering team's review remains necessary.
Does the integration automatically include PDM?
No. Any PDM environment requires separate assessment of version, permissions and expected operations. The presence of SOLIDWORKS does not establish that all PDM functions are accessible.
Can we use our usual AI assistant?
Test the selected client with the server, connection method and access controls. Announce only the configurations and operations actually validated rather than promising compatibility with every assistant or version.
